3. A cozy rustic card holder
Your Christmas cards need a special place. On the front door, you can make a rustic card holder to place your beautiful cards received from your family or friends. Every time you get home this will put a smile on your face before entering the house and a positive attitude is the perfect antidote to a tiring day. A long piece of wood, burlap or Christmas prints and some laundry clips spray painted – that’s all you need to make an adorable card display.

7. Festive pinecones
Create a charming and welcoming porch with a few pinecones, fir or pine branches, red globes and flowerpots. A totally not expensive but attractive decoration for Christmas.

10. Green beautiful decorations
Since it’s winter and everything is white around your house, you have to add some color to contrast the surrounding decor. Do you happen to have a metal bucket or an old boiler in your garage? If the answer is yes, then all you need is to cut a round piece of metal and to fill it with pine or fir. As a bonus, you can add a red bow for a bigger impact.
